
Excel表格怎么计算总数?
在Excel表格中计算总数的方法主要包括使用SUM函数、自动求和功能、以及通过公式手动计算等方式。SUM函数、自动求和、手动公式是最常用的三种方法。下面将详细介绍SUM函数的使用,这是最常见且便捷的方式。
SUM函数是Excel中最常用的函数之一,用于计算一组数字的总和。使用SUM函数的步骤如下:
- 选择需要计算总和的单元格区域。
- 在目标单元格中输入公式“=SUM(选择的单元格区域)”,例如“=SUM(A1:A10)”,然后按下回车键即可。
一、SUM函数的使用方法
SUM函数是Excel中最基本也是最常用的求和工具。它可以对指定范围内的数字进行求和计算。下面是详细的使用步骤和注意事项:
1、基本用法
首先,选择你想要计算总和的单元格区域。例如,你想要对A列的前10个单元格求和,你可以在任意一个空白单元格中输入公式“=SUM(A1:A10)”,然后按下回车键即可得到结果。
2、多个区域求和
如果需要对多个不连续的区域进行求和,也可以使用SUM函数。例如,你想要对A列的前10个单元格和B列的前10个单元格求和,可以输入公式“=SUM(A1:A10, B1:B10)”。
3、使用名称管理器
为了更加方便的管理和计算,可以使用名称管理器来定义一个区域的名称。首先,选中你需要定义的区域,然后点击“公式”选项卡中的“定义名称”,给这个区域命名。之后,你可以在SUM函数中直接使用这个名称,例如“=SUM(区域名称)”。
4、处理空单元格
在实际操作中,可能会遇到一些空单元格。SUM函数会自动忽略这些空单元格,只对有数值的单元格进行求和。因此不需要担心空单元格的问题。
二、自动求和功能
Excel提供了一个自动求和功能,可以快速对选中的单元格区域进行求和。这个功能特别适合在处理大批量数据时使用,能够极大提高工作效率。
1、使用自动求和按钮
在Excel中,选择你想要求和的区域,然后点击工具栏中的“自动求和”按钮(通常在“开始”选项卡下)。Excel会自动在选中的区域下方或右侧插入一个求和公式,并显示总和。
2、自定义求和区域
有时候自动求和功能会猜测你需要求和的区域,但如果它没有猜对,可以手动调整。选中你想要计算的区域后,再次点击“自动求和”按钮,然后手动调整求和公式中的区域。
三、手动公式计算
除了使用SUM函数和自动求和功能外,还可以通过手动输入公式来计算总数。这种方法适合处理一些特殊的计算需求。
1、简单加法公式
可以直接在单元格中输入加法公式,例如“=A1+A2+A3”,然后按下回车键即可得到结果。这种方法适用于计算少量单元格的总和。
2、使用加号连接多个单元格
如果需要对多个不连续的单元格求和,可以使用加号连接这些单元格,例如“=A1+B2+C3”。这种方法虽然简单,但不适合计算大量数据。
四、使用数据透视表
数据透视表是Excel中一个非常强大的工具,除了可以对数据进行汇总、分类和筛选外,还可以用来计算总数。
1、创建数据透视表
首先,选中你需要分析的数据区域,然后点击“插入”选项卡中的“数据透视表”按钮。在弹出的对话框中,选择数据源和放置数据透视表的位置,然后点击“确定”。
2、添加字段到值区域
在数据透视表的字段列表中,将你需要计算总和的字段拖到“值”区域。Excel会自动对这个字段进行求和,并在数据透视表中显示结果。
五、使用数组公式
数组公式是Excel中的高级功能,可以用于处理复杂的计算需求。通过数组公式,可以一次性对多个单元格进行计算,并返回一个或多个结果。
1、输入数组公式
选中你需要计算的区域,然后在公式栏中输入数组公式,例如“=SUM(A1:A10*B1:B10)”,然后按下Ctrl+Shift+Enter键。Excel会在公式两端加上花括号,并计算结果。
2、使用数组常量
除了引用单元格区域外,还可以在数组公式中使用数组常量。例如,“=SUM({1,2,3,4,5}*{6,7,8,9,10})”会计算两个数组的乘积之和。
六、使用其他函数进行求和
除了SUM函数外,Excel中还有一些其他函数可以用于求和,例如SUMIF、SUMIFS、SUBTOTAL等。这些函数可以根据特定条件对数据进行求和。
1、SUMIF函数
SUMIF函数可以根据单个条件对数据进行求和。例如,“=SUMIF(A1:A10, ">5", B1:B10)”会对A列中大于5的对应B列数值进行求和。
2、SUMIFS函数
SUMIFS函数可以根据多个条件对数据进行求和。例如,“=SUMIFS(B1:B10, A1:A10, ">5", C1:C10, "<10")”会对A列大于5且C列小于10的对应B列数值进行求和。
3、SUBTOTAL函数
SUBTOTAL函数可以对数据进行分组求和,并且可以忽略隐藏的行。例如,“=SUBTOTAL(9, A1:A10)”会对A列前10个单元格进行求和,而忽略隐藏的行。
七、使用VBA宏进行求和
对于一些高级用户,可以使用VBA宏来进行求和计算。VBA宏可以实现一些复杂的计算需求,并且可以自动化处理。
1、创建一个简单的VBA宏
打开Excel的VBA编辑器(按下Alt+F11),然后插入一个新模块。在模块中输入以下代码:
Sub SumRange()
Dim rng As Range
Dim total As Double
Set rng = Range("A1:A10")
total = Application.WorksheetFunction.Sum(rng)
MsgBox "Total is " & total
End Sub
关闭VBA编辑器,然后在Excel中运行这个宏(按下Alt+F8),会弹出一个消息框显示总和。
2、自动化处理
可以将VBA宏与按钮或其他控件关联,实现自动化处理。例如,可以在Excel中插入一个按钮,然后将其与上面的SumRange宏关联。这样,每当点击按钮时,宏会自动运行并显示总和。
八、使用第三方插件
除了Excel本身的功能外,还有一些第三方插件可以帮助你进行求和计算。这些插件通常提供更强大的功能和更友好的界面,适合处理复杂的数据分析需求。
1、Power Query
Power Query是Excel中的一个数据处理工具,可以用于从各种数据源导入和处理数据。通过Power Query,可以对数据进行清洗、转换和汇总,从而实现求和计算。
2、Power Pivot
Power Pivot是Excel中的一个数据建模工具,可以用于处理大规模数据和复杂的数据分析需求。通过Power Pivot,可以创建数据模型,并使用DAX函数进行求和计算。
九、使用图表进行求和
Excel中的图表不仅可以用于数据可视化,还可以用于求和计算。通过在图表中添加数据标签和数据表,可以直观地显示总和结果。
1、创建图表
首先,选中你需要分析的数据区域,然后点击“插入”选项卡中的“图表”按钮,选择一个合适的图表类型。Excel会自动生成一个图表,并在图表中显示数据。
2、添加数据标签
在图表中右键点击数据系列,然后选择“添加数据标签”。Excel会在图表中显示每个数据点的数值。通过这些数据标签,可以直观地看到每个数据点的数值总和。
十、处理常见问题和错误
在实际操作中,可能会遇到一些常见问题和错误。例如,SUM函数返回错误值、自动求和功能不起作用等。下面是一些解决方法:
1、SUM函数返回错误值
如果SUM函数返回错误值,可能是因为数据区域中包含了非数值数据。可以使用ISNUMBER函数检查数据区域,并删除非数值数据。
2、自动求和功能不起作用
如果自动求和功能不起作用,可能是因为数据区域中包含了隐藏的行或列。可以使用SUBTOTAL函数替代自动求和功能,从而忽略隐藏的行或列。
总结
在Excel中计算总数的方法多种多样,包括使用SUM函数、自动求和功能、手动公式计算、数据透视表、数组公式、其他求和函数、VBA宏、第三方插件和图表等。每种方法都有其优点和适用场景,可以根据具体需求选择合适的方法。通过掌握这些技巧,可以大大提高工作效率和数据分析能力。
相关问答FAQs:
1. 如何在Excel表格中计算某一列的总数?
要在Excel表格中计算某一列的总数,您可以使用SUM函数。首先,在需要计算总数的单元格中输入"=SUM(",然后选择需要计算总数的区域,最后输入")"并按下Enter键即可得出总数。
2. 如何在Excel表格中计算多个列的总和?
要计算多个列的总和,您可以使用SUM函数的扩展用法。在需要计算总和的单元格中输入"=SUM(",然后选择第一个列的区域,输入"+",再选择第二个列的区域,以此类推,最后输入")"并按下Enter键即可得出多个列的总和。
3. 如何在Excel表格中计算满足特定条件的单元格的总数?
要计算满足特定条件的单元格的总数,您可以使用SUMIF函数。首先,在需要计算总数的单元格中输入"=SUMIF(",然后选择需要进行条件判断的区域,输入条件,再选择需要计算总数的区域,最后输入")"并按下Enter键即可得出满足条件的单元格的总数。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4233546